Targeting Cartilage miR-195/497 Cluster for Osteoarthritis Treatment Regulates the Circadian Clock

Shi Shi,
Lele Zhang,
Qi Wang
et al.

Abstract: Introduction: Osteoarthritis (OA) is the most prevalent and debilitating joint disease without an effective therapeutic option. Multiple risk factors for OA have been identified, including abnormal chondrocyte miRNA secretion and circadian rhythms disruption, both of which have been found to cause progressive damage and loss of articular cartilage.
